Invariant Center Power and Elliptic Loci of Poncelet Triangles
Abstract
We study center power with respect to circles derived from Poncelet 3-periodics (triangles) in a generic pair of ellipses as well as loci of their triangle centers. We show that (i) for any concentric pair, the power of the center with respect to either circumcircle or Euler's circle is invariant, and (ii) if a triangle center of a 3-periodic in a generic nested pair is a fixed affine combination of barycenter and circumcenter, its locus over the family is an ellipse.
